About The Position

The Corporate Communications Intern will gain hands-on experience in internal communications, public speaking, business solutions, public relations, employee engagement, content creation, social media, digital communications, and brand management while contributing to company-wide initiatives. The intern will be responsible for completing all tasks outlined in their summer project plans assigned by managers.  Interns must participate in all mandatory internship programming, evaluation periods and professional development sessions.   Attending sessions remotely will be determined and approved by program manager.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in communications, video production, media studies, public relations , business management, journalism , graphic design, or a related field
  • E xperience in content creation, public relations, marketing, or digital media
  • Proficiency in written and verbal communication
  • Experience with social media platforms
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ively
  • Valid driver’s license and insurability under company policy
  • Ability to lift and move up to 25 lbs and operate multimedia equipment

Responsibilities

  • Assist in developing and executing communication plans that align with company goals
  • Write, design, and edit content for newsletters, reports, press releases, websites, and social media
  • Coordinate photo and video content creation and maintain digital asset libraries
  • Provide support for internal and external events including planning, materials, and on-site presence
  • Engage with the public, media, and community partners to promote brand awareness
  • Ensure brand consistency and usability across all communications and design materials
  • Collaborate with internal teams to gather information for content development
  • Manage production timelines, printing estimates, and vendor coordination for communications materials
  • Monitor social media accounts, recommending content strategies as needed
  • Research industry trends and best practices in communications and marketing
  • Assist with marketing project coordination, file organization, and task tracking
  • Travel occasionally to support events and outreach initiatives
  • Perform other duties as assigned
